On July 26-27, yet another important page in the history of Philippine-Japan relations will be written with the visit to the Philippines of His Excellency Shinzo Abe, Prime Minister of Japan, on the invitation of His Excellency President Benigno S. Aquino III.

The visit attests to the particular importance given by the Abe Government to the Philippines, being one of Japan’s recognized bilateral strategic partners. Since 1956, bilateral relations have been mutually beneficial and characterized by cooperation in a wide range of fields. More importantly, Philippines-Japan ties stand out in the region for being underpinned by a strong shared adherence to the values of democracy, humanitarian principles and the rule of law.
